Output f61ba33c34ce794a807e27935d9bd4a628fe0d3f545a14d8de4bd2e6bf0d15e7:0

value
1128464
script pubkey
OP_0 OP_PUSHBYTES_20 b3f247552986a1d04f4411d19b01db5203da0813
address
bc1qk0eyw4ffs6saqn6yz8gekqwm2gpa5zqn3yv9rc
transaction
f61ba33c34ce794a807e27935d9bd4a628fe0d3f545a14d8de4bd2e6bf0d15e7
confirmations
162423
spent
true